Charles Prince 1927–2003 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 17 Aug 1927
Birth Location: East Orange, New Jersey
Death Date: 7 May 2003
Death Location: Largo, Pinellas, Florida, USA
Father: Russell Prince
Mother: Theresa Saber
Spouse(s): Mary Smith
Children(s):
In 1927, Charles Prince entered the world in East Orange, New Jersey, born to Russell Prince And Theresa Saber. In 1935, Charles Prince resided in St Petersburg, Pinellas, Florida. In 1940, Charles Prince resided in Precinct 20, St Petersburg, Pinellas, Florida, USA. Charles Prince married Mary Smith. Charles Prince passed away in 2003 in Largo, Pinellas, Florida, USA.
